আমি কীভাবে জাভা ইক্লিপস প্রকল্পের জন্য ট্র্যাভিস সিআই বিল্ড টেস্টিং কনফিগার করব?


11

আমার গিটহাবে একটি এক্সপ্লিপ জাভা প্রকল্প রয়েছে। আমি ট্র্যাভিস সিআই-এর সাথে অটো-বিল্ডিং পরীক্ষার সেট আপ করতে চাই। যাইহোক, আমি যখন আমার প্রকল্পের জন্য বিল্ড টেস্টিং সক্ষম করি তখন সংকলন সর্বদা নিম্নলিখিত ত্রুটির সাথে ব্যর্থ হয়।

Buildfile: build.xml does not exist!
Build failed

The command "ant test" exited with 1.

আমার জাভা এক্সিলিপ প্রকল্পের জন্য বিল্ড পরীক্ষা চালানোর জন্য ট্র্যাভিস সিআইকে কীভাবে কনফিগার করব?

উত্তর:


10

সবচেয়ে সহজ পদ্ধতিটি হ'ল আপনার জন্য গ্রহনটি একটি পিঁপড়া তৈরির স্ক্রিপ্ট তৈরি করে।

প্যাকেজ এক্সপ্লোরারটিতে আপনার প্রকল্পে ডান ক্লিক করুন এবং প্রসঙ্গ মেনুতে রফতানি নির্বাচন করুন । রফতানির ধরণটি সাধারণ -> পিঁপড়া বিল্ডফিলগুলি চয়ন করুন এবং পরবর্তী ক্লিক করুন ।

রেকর্ড মেনু স্ক্রিনশট

পরবর্তী স্ক্রিনে, নিশ্চিত হয়ে নিন যে আপনার প্রকল্পটি নির্বাচিত হয়েছে। আপনি তাদের ডিফল্ট সেটিংসে বিকল্পগুলি রেখে যেতে পারেন। আপনার ফাইলটি তৈরি করতে সমাপ্তিতে ক্লিক build.xmlকরুন।

অ্যান্টিফায়াল ডায়ালগের স্ক্রিনশট তৈরি করুন

শেষ অবধি , ট্র্যাভিস সিআই সঠিকভাবে এই প্রকল্পটি চালায় তা নিশ্চিত করার জন্য, আপনার প্রকল্পের মূল ফোল্ডারে একটি ট্রাভিস.আইএমএল তৈরি করুন । জাভা প্রকল্পগুলির জন্য এটিতে কমপক্ষে নিম্নলিখিতটি থাকা উচিত।

language: java
jdk:
  - oraclejdk8

script: ant build

উত্স: কোফুন ডেভব্লগ - জাভা ইক্লিপস প্রকল্পের সাথে ট্র্যাভিস সিআই ব্যবহার করে

আ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.